The chart below shows the total number of minutes (in billions) of telephone
calls in the UK, divided into three categories, from 1995-2002.
Here's my suggested outline for a 4-paragraph report:
Introduction: rewrite the question statement in your own words.
Overview: point out which category was highest in each year, which was

lowest, and which saw the biggest changes.
Details: compare the 3 categories in 1995, then say what happened up until
1999.
Details: notice what happened to local calls from 1999 onwards, and contrast
this with the other 2 categories. Finish with a comparison of the figures in
2002.

The bar chart compares the amount of time spent by people in the UK on three
different types of phone call between 1995 and 2002.
It is clear that calls made via local, fixed lines were the most popular
type, in terms of overall usage, throughout the period shown. The lowest figures
on the chart are for mobile calls, but this category also saw the most dramatic
increase in user minutes.
In 1995, people in the UK used fixed lines for a total of just over 70
billion minutes for local calls, and about half of that amount of time for
national or international calls. By contrast, mobile phones were only used for
around 4 billion minutes. Over the following four years, the figures for all
three types of phone call increased steadily.
By 1999, the amount of time spent on local calls using landlines had reached
a peak at 90 billion minutes. Subsequently, the figure for this category fell,
but the rise in the other two types of phone call continued. In 2002, the number
of minutes of national / international landline calls passed 60 billion, while
the figure for mobiles rose to around 45 billion minutes.
(197 words, band 9)
